What Players Should Check Before Signing In
Before entering credentials, confirm that the web address is correct and that the connection is secure. A padlock symbol is helpful, although it is not a magic certificate of honesty. It only indicates encrypted communication. The operator’s licensing information, responsible gambling tools, privacy policy, and withdrawal conditions deserve equal attention.
- Check that the login page uses a secure connection and the correct domain.
- Use a unique password that is not shared with email, banking, or social accounts.
- Look for two-factor authentication or other account-protection options.
- Read the account-verification policy before making a deposit.
- Review local availability and age requirements.
Public Wi-Fi is a poor place for casino administration. A crowded café network may be convenient, but it is not where anyone should be managing payment details. A private connection, updated browser, and password manager create a less dramatic but much safer routine than relying on memory and optimism.
Login, Registration, and Verification
New users usually need to provide personal details during registration, while returning players can sign in with an email address, username, or mobile number. The exact fields vary by platform, but the logic is familiar: the operator needs enough information to identify the account and comply with anti-money-laundering obligations.
Verification can request an identity document, proof of address, or payment confirmation. This may feel inconvenient, particularly when it appears near a withdrawal request, yet it is a normal part of regulated gambling. The less welcome interpretation is also worth mentioning: if a casino explains verification poorly, players may face delays simply because the process was never clear.

When the Login Fails
Forgotten passwords are hardly a personal tragedy, though websites occasionally present them with the solemnity of one. The password-reset link should be used instead of repeatedly guessing credentials. Too many failed attempts can trigger a temporary lock, and random experimentation rarely improves the situation.
If an email does not arrive, inspect the spam folder, confirm the registered address, and wait briefly before requesting another reset. Multiple reset requests can create several active links, turning a simple fix into a small administrative maze. Players should never send passwords or full payment details to support staff.
Common Problems and Sensible Responses
- Locked account: Contact official support and ask about the unlock procedure.
- Incorrect credentials: Use the reset option rather than trying endless combinations.
- Unavailable page: Check maintenance notices, browser updates, and the official domain.
- Verification delay: Confirm that documents are readable and match registration data.
- Suspicious messages: Avoid links in unsolicited emails and access the site manually.
Payments, Bonuses, and Account Conditions
Once access is restored, the account area usually contains deposits, withdrawals, transaction history, limits, and promotional terms. These sections deserve more attention than a brightly coloured banner. A deposit offer may include wagering requirements, maximum cashout rules, eligible games, expiry dates, and contribution percentages that change the practical value of the promotion.
Payment speed should also be judged carefully. Deposits are often processed quickly because casinos enjoy receiving money at impressive velocity. Withdrawals can involve verification, internal review, method restrictions, or bank processing times. Before staking funds, check minimum and maximum amounts, fees, currencies, and whether the chosen payment method supports withdrawals.
Responsible Use of a Casino Account
A secure login protects an account; it does not make gambling harmless. Set a budget before playing, use deposit or loss limits where available, and treat results as uncertain rather than as income. Chasing a losing session is the classic casino trap: it promises recovery while quietly asking for another deposit.
Players who feel distracted, pressured, or unable to stop should pause access and contact a recognised gambling-support service. Self-exclusion tools can create useful distance, and reputable operators should provide clear instructions. The sensible win is not a dramatic jackpot story; it is retaining control when the numbers refuse to cooperate.
